Homeless 

Homeless man sitting in the corner 

Of a car park that leads to the shops,

Homeless man sitting in the corner

Of a car park hoping someone will stop,

Offer him a coffee or a tea a sandwich or something to nourish him.

As I see him sitting there in a state of cold despair,

I wonder why and what happened to his life and why no one cares,

Apart from three random person who stops

And shows him kindness and compassion,

Through the offering of drink and food.

But is this enough because on every corner there are more

And maybe we should address the problem at the core,

That with so many people who have way too much,

How are there people that just don’t have enough.

Does this define the failing of the state

And an obvious decline of how people a treated in society today.

So many questions,

To few answers

And so the problem just goes on and on,

Until we become sanitised 

And learn not to see,

They become blind to our eyes

So we no longer see,

The homeless man sitting in the corner 

Of a car park that leads to the shops

Homeless man sitting in the corner

Of a car park hoping someone will stop.
